S82.499G
ICD-10-CMOther fracture of shaft of unspecified fibula, subsequent encounter for closed fracture with delayed healing
This code signifies a follow-up encounter for a fracture affecting the shaft of the fibula, where the specific bone (left or right) is not documented. The fracture is closed, meaning the skin remains intact, and the healing process is progressing slower than expected.
Apply this code when a patient presents for ongoing management of a fibular shaft fracture that is not healing within the typical timeframe. This includes situations where imaging shows persistent fracture lines or callus formation is delayed, and the encounter is not for initial treatment or sequelae.
